Ingredients

Serves 8
Produce
  • 1/2 tsp grated lemon zest
  • 4 medium peaches (about 1 lb, pitted, peeled* and sliced into cubes (2 1/4 cups chopped))
Proteins
  • 3 large eggs (room temperature)
Dairy & sauces
  • 1/4 tsp vanilla extract
Pantry & spices
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our (or gluten-free flour)
  • 1 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 3/4 cup unsalted butter (1 1/2 sticks, softened)
  • Confectioners' sugar for dusting

Open in Supper to scale servings and turn this into a grocery list.

Steps

  1. Step 1

    Prep: Heat oven to 350˚F. Grease a 9-inch springform pan with cooking spray.

  2. Step 2

    In a small bowl, whisk together 1 1/2 cups flour, 1 1/2 tsp baking powder, and 1/4 tsp salt.

  3. Step 3

    In a large bowl, beat together 1 1/2 sticks of butter with 1 cup sugar on med/high speed until fluffy (4-5 minutes).

  4. Step 4

    Beat in 3 large eggs, 1 at a time allowing them to incorporate into the batter before adding the next egg then continue mixing for another minute on med/high speed. Once the mixture is well blended, beat in 1/2 tsp fresh lemon zest and 1/4 tsp vanilla extract.

  5. Step 5

    Set mixer to low and beat in your flour mixture just until blended.

  6. Step 6

    Use a spatula to fold in the peaches just until evenly dispersed then transfer batter to your prepared springform pan and bake in the center of the oven at 350˚F for 50-60 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Remove from oven and let cool to room temp before sprinkling the top with confectioners sugar.**
